Clearly Define the Role and Responsibilities
- Key Responsibilities: Entry Level GIS Analysts are primarily responsible for collecting, processing, and analyzing spatial data using GIS software. Their daily tasks often include digitizing maps, updating geospatial databases, performing spatial analyses, and creating visual representations such as maps and charts. They may also assist in data quality assurance, support field data collection efforts, and generate reports for internal and external stakeholders. In medium to large businesses, these analysts often collaborate with engineering, planning, marketing, and operations teams to provide geospatial insights that inform business strategies and operational decisions.
- Experience Levels: While the focus here is on entry-level roles, it is important to understand the progression within the GIS Analyst career path. Entry Level GIS Analysts typically have 0-2 years of experience and are expected to have foundational knowledge of GIS principles and software. Mid-level GIS Analysts generally possess 2-5 years of experience, taking on more complex analyses and project management responsibilities. Senior GIS Analysts, with 5+ years of experience, often lead teams, design workflows, and drive innovation in GIS applications. Each level requires a deeper understanding of spatial analysis, data management, and industry-specific applications.
- Company Fit: The requirements for an Entry Level GIS Analyst can vary depending on company size and industry focus. In medium-sized companies (50-500 employees), analysts may be expected to wear multiple hats, supporting a variety of projects and departments. Flexibility and a broad skill set are often valued. In larger organizations (500+ employees), roles may be more specialized, with analysts focusing on specific data types, industries, or workflows. Larger companies may also offer more structured training and advancement opportunities, while medium-sized businesses may provide greater exposure to diverse projects and faster career growth.
Certifications
Certifications play a significant role in validating an Entry Level GIS Analyst's technical proficiency and commitment to professional development. While not always mandatory for entry-level positions, certifications can distinguish candidates in a competitive job market and provide assurance to employers regarding a candidate's foundational knowledge and skills.
One of the most recognized certifications in the GIS field is the Esri Technical Certification, offered by Esri, the leading provider of GIS software. The Esri ArcGIS Desktop Entry certification is particularly relevant for entry-level analysts. This certification assesses a candidate's ability to use ArcGIS software for basic mapping, data management, and analysis tasks. To earn this credential, candidates must pass a proctored exam that covers topics such as map creation, spatial analysis, and data visualization. While formal prerequisites are not required, hands-on experience with ArcGIS and completion of Esri's online training modules are highly recommended.
Another valuable credential is the GIS Certification Institute's (GISCI) Geographic Information Systems Professional (GISP) certification. While the GISP is typically pursued by more experienced professionals, entry-level analysts can begin accumulating the necessary education, experience, and contributions to the profession to qualify in the future. The GISP certification requires a combination of formal education, professional experience, and contributions to the GIS community, culminating in a comprehensive portfolio review and exam.
For those interested in open-source GIS technologies, the QGIS Certification Program offers training and certification in the use of QGIS, a popular free and open-source GIS platform. These certifications are often provided by authorized training centers and can demonstrate proficiency in alternative GIS tools beyond Esri products.
Additionally, many universities and technical colleges offer certificate programs in GIS that provide structured coursework and practical experience. These academic certificates can be particularly valuable for candidates transitioning from related fields or seeking to formalize their GIS education.

Assess Technical Skills
- Tools and Software: Entry Level GIS Analysts should demonstrate proficiency in industry-standard GIS software, with Esri's ArcGIS suite (ArcMap, ArcGIS Pro) being the most widely used in commercial and government settings. Familiarity with QGIS, an open-source alternative, is increasingly valued, especially in organizations seeking cost-effective solutions. Analysts should also be comfortable with spatial databases such as PostgreSQL/PostGIS or Microsoft SQL Server, as well as data visualization tools like Tableau or Power BI. Basic knowledge of programming languages such as Python or R is advantageous, as these are commonly used for automating geoprocessing tasks and performing advanced spatial analyses. Experience with GPS devices, remote sensing software (e.g., ERDAS IMAGINE, ENVI), and web mapping platforms (e.g., ArcGIS Online, Leaflet) can further enhance a candidate's profile.
- Assessments: Evaluating technical proficiency is crucial during the hiring process. Practical assessments may include tasks such as creating a thematic map from raw spatial data, performing a buffer analysis, or converting data between coordinate systems. Employers can administer software-specific tests or request a portfolio of previous GIS projects, including academic assignments or internships. Scenario-based interviews, where candidates are asked to solve real-world spatial problems, provide insight into their analytical approach and familiarity with relevant tools. Online assessment platforms and technical screening tools can also be used to verify skills in ArcGIS, QGIS, or Python scripting. By combining practical evaluations with targeted interview questions, hiring managers can ensure candidates possess the technical foundation required for success as an Entry Level GIS Analyst.
Evaluate Soft Skills and Cultural Fit
- Communication: Effective communication is essential for Entry Level GIS Analysts, as they frequently collaborate with cross-functional teams, including engineers, planners, project managers, and non-technical stakeholders. Analysts must be able to translate complex spatial data into clear, actionable insights and present findings in a way that is accessible to diverse audiences. Strong written communication skills are necessary for preparing reports, documentation, and data visualizations, while verbal skills are critical for participating in meetings, delivering presentations, and responding to questions from colleagues or clients. During interviews, look for candidates who can articulate their thought process, explain technical concepts simply, and demonstrate active listening.
- Problem-Solving: GIS projects often involve unique challenges, such as incomplete data, conflicting sources, or evolving project requirements. Entry Level GIS Analysts should exhibit strong problem-solving abilities, including logical reasoning, adaptability, and a willingness to learn new techniques. During interviews, present candidates with hypothetical scenarios or past project challenges to assess how they approach problem identification, analysis, and solution development. Look for evidence of resourcefulness, creativity, and the ability to work independently or as part of a team to overcome obstacles.
- Attention to Detail: Precision is critical in GIS work, as small errors in data entry, analysis, or map production can lead to significant downstream impacts. Entry Level GIS Analysts must demonstrate meticulous attention to detail, ensuring data accuracy and consistency throughout all project phases. To assess this trait, consider including exercises that require careful data review or error identification, or ask candidates to describe their quality control processes in previous projects. References from past supervisors or professors can also provide insight into a candidate's reliability and thoroughness.

Offer Competitive Compensation and Benefits
- Market Rates: Compensation for Entry Level GIS Analysts varies based on geographic location, industry, and company size. In the United States, entry-level salaries typically range from $45,000 to $60,000 per year, with higher rates in major metropolitan areas or industries such as energy, utilities, and technology. Analysts working in government or non-profit sectors may earn slightly less but often benefit from greater job stability and comprehensive benefits. In regions with a high demand for GIS skills, such as California, Texas, or the Northeast, starting salaries can exceed $60,000, especially for candidates with strong technical skills or relevant internships. Employers should regularly benchmark their compensation packages against industry standards to remain competitive and attract top talent.
